An old tree stump is more than an eyesore — it attracts termites and carpenter ants, interferes with mowing, creates a tripping hazard, and can sprout new growth. Gibson Tree Service provides professional stump grinding throughout the Miami Valley, eliminating stumps quickly and cleanly.
We use professional-grade stump grinders to grind stumps 6–12 inches below grade level. This allows you to cover the area with topsoil and seed grass, or prepare it for new plantings. Most residential stumps take 15–45 minutes to grind.
Pricing: Stump grinding typically costs $100–$400 per stump depending on diameter. We provide upfront quotes before any work begins.

Unlike stump grinding, full stump removal extracts the entire stump and root system from the ground. This is the best option when you need the area completely clear — for new construction, major landscaping, or when the root system is causing underground problems.
We use professional excavators and stump pullers to remove the entire root ball. After extraction, we backfill the hole with clean fill, grade the area, and haul away all debris.
